Mr Finney


Mr Finney had a turnip,
And it grew and it grew;
And it grew behind the barn,
And the turnip did no harm.

There it grew and it grew
Till it could grow no longer;
Then his daughter Lizzie picked it
And put it in the celler.

There it lay and it lay
Till it began to rot;
And his daughter Susie took it
And put it in the pot.

And they boiled it and boiled it
As long as they were able;
And then his daughters took it
And put it on the table.

Mr Finney and his wife
They sat down to sup;
And they ate and they ate
And they ate that turnip up.
